virt-log(1) | Virtualization Support | virt-log(1) |
virt-log - Display log files from a virtual machine
virt-log [--options] -d domname virt-log [--options] -a disk.img [-a disk.img ...]
"virt-log" is a command line tool to display the log files from the named virtual machine (or disk image).
This tool understands and displays both plain text log files (eg. /var/log/messages) and binary formats such as the systemd journal.
To display other types of files, use virt-cat(1). To follow (tail) text log files, use virt-tail(1). To copy files out of a virtual machine, use virt-copy-out(1). To display the contents of the Windows Registry, use virt-win-reg(1).
Display the complete logs from a guest:
virt-log -d mydomain | less
仮想マシンが取得している DHCP IP アドレスを発見するには:
virt-log -d mydomain | grep 'dhclient.*bound to'
ディスクイメージの形式は自動検知されます。 これを上書きして強制的に特定の形式を使用する場合、 --format=.. オプションを使用します。
ゲストのブロックデバイスを直接指定していると((-a))、libvirt は何も使用されません。
例:
virt-log --format=raw -a disk.img
forces raw format (no auto-detection) for disk.img.
virt-log --format=raw -a disk.img --format -a another.img
forces raw format (no auto-detection) for disk.img and reverts to auto-detection for another.img.
仮想マシンのディスクイメージが信頼できない raw 形式である場合、 ディスク形式を指定するためにこのオプションを使用すべきです。 これにより、悪意のある仮想マシンにより起こり得る セキュリティ問題を回避できます (CVE-2010-3851)。
If there are multiple encrypted devices then you may need to supply multiple keys on stdin, one per line.
このプログラムは、成功すると 0 を、エラーがあると 0 以外を返します。
guestfs(3), guestfish(1), virt-cat(1), virt-copy-out(1), virt-tail(1), virt-tar-out(1), virt-win-reg(1), http://libguestfs.org/.
Richard W.M. Jones http://people.redhat.com/~rjones/
Copyright (C) 2010-2020 Red Hat Inc.
To get a list of bugs against libguestfs, use this link: https://bugzilla.redhat.com/buglist.cgi?component=libguestfs&product=Virtualization+Tools
To report a new bug against libguestfs, use this link: https://bugzilla.redhat.com/enter_bug.cgi?component=libguestfs&product=Virtualization+Tools
When reporting a bug, please supply:
2022-05-26 | guestfs-tools-1.48.2 |